The Oregon EBT Card, which is also known as the Oregon Trail Card is a debit-like card that can be used at eligible grocery stores to redeem food stamp benefits. Furthermore, it is the Oregon Department of Human Services (DHS), that is responsible for administering the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P), also called the Food Stamp Program.

The main of SNAP is to assist low-income households to obtain a healthy diet, thereby eliminating hunger by increasing their purchasing power at grocery stores through food assistance benefits.

Every month, benefits are distributed to Oregon SNAP recipients via a plastic EBT card, and it can be used to purchase approved food items. Oregon EBT Card Balance
So, in order to check your Oregon Trail Card balance, kindly follow the below procedure.

Steps To Check Oregon EBT Card Balance

There are two options available for you to check the balance on your Oregon Trail EBT Card. Follow the process below to get started.

Option 1: Check your Last Receipt

This option of checking your Oregon Trail EBT card balance is the easiest and quickest way to find the current balance on your Oregon Trail Card. It means you can see the remaining balance when you check your last receipt.

The balance is stated at the bottom of your last grocery store or ATM receipt. in another ward, ensure to always keep your last receipt when using your EBT Card.

Option 2: Call the Oregon SNAP Customer Service

Another option for checking your Oregon Trail EBT card balance is by phone. To check your EBT balance by phone, contact the Oregon SNAP Customer Service Hotline.

The Oregon SNAP Customer Service Phone Number is 1-888-997-4447 and the hotline is open to Oregon SNAP beneficiaries 24 hours 7 days a week.

NOTE: Ensure that you have your EBT card number and 4-digit personal identification number (PIN) ready before you call. This is because you must provide the agent with this information prior to receiving your Oregon Trail card balance.

Option 3: Log in to your Edge EBT Account

The last option for checking your Oregon Trail EBT card balance is online, by visiting the ebtEDGE website. Simply login to the website with your User ID and password. Then type in your card number in the space provided to check your balance.

Not only that you’ll be able to view your current balance, but also you an as well see your transaction history. If you are new to the website and you do not have an ebtEDGE account, you can create a User Account which is free.
